Chemical Composition - (Typical Analysis in %)
| STANDARDS | X37CrMoW5-1 | H12 | DIN 2606 | AISI H12 | AFNOR 32CDV12-28 | JIS SKD62 |
| C | Si | Mn | P | S | Cr | W | Mo | V |
| 0.30-0.40 | 0.80-1.25 | 0.20-0.60 | 0.003 max | 0.030max | 4.75-5.50 | 1.00-1.70 | 1.25-1.75 | 0.20-0.50 |
| USA | Germany | Japan | British |
| AISI / SAE | DIN, WNr | JIS G4404 | BS 4659 |
| H12 / T20812 | 1.2605 / X35CrWMoV5 | SKD62 | BH12 |
Physical Properties
| Coefficient of Thermal Expansion at °C | 10¯m / (m*K) |
| 20-100 | 11.7 |
| 20-250 | 12.4 |
| 20-500 | 12.9 |
| Tempering°C after quenching | 100 | 210 | 300 | 400 | 500 | 600 | 700 | 800 | 900 |
| HRC | 55 | 54 | 54.3 | 54.8 | 51 | 48 | 41 | 34 |
